New York Liberty forward/guard Betnijah Laney-Hamilton is ejected after a shoe-throwing incident late in the fourth quarter of the Liberty’s 93-91 loss to the Toronto Tempo. Multiple outlets report that with 1:48 remaining, Laney-Hamilton throws a shoe that strikes Tempo guard Marina Mabrey in the back. The sequence includes a sneaker falling off and Laney-Hamilton appearing to try to return the shoe to teammate Jonquel Jones. Instead, the tossed shoe reaches Mabrey and leads to an immediate ejection.

CBS Sports also reports that the Liberty coaching staff criticizes officiating afterward, calling the calls “pathetic,” though the reports agree on the core incident: the shoe is thrown during the game’s closing minutes, Mabrey is hit, and Laney-Hamilton is removed from play as the Liberty rally attempt is derailed. The game result remains the same across sources: Toronto defeats New York 93-91.
